Output a5d889c3d3871333d07ad52a6e1aa8cedb53bd6df9d3f90acb22abcb07715423:0

value
37907267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ba14aa338a9d584c487fe8a2d2e66255bae91d OP_EQUAL
address
3AscQqnqLWwMpYUUjYCKHPqkcWezhxAJCt
transaction
a5d889c3d3871333d07ad52a6e1aa8cedb53bd6df9d3f90acb22abcb07715423
spent
true